Notre Dame football and FedEx Cup collide

And I thought one of the purposes of creating the FedEx Cup playoffs was to be able to compete with football, not get sidelined.  Jon Show sheds some light on the subject, and it doesn't look good for the Tour...

Scheduling conflicts will force the final two FedEx Cup playoff events to move up their time windows to accommodate NBC’s commitment to air Notre Dame home football games, which could further affect television ratings for events that will already suffer from the absence of Tiger Woods.

Golf ratings for tournaments generally increase as the television window stretches into early evening in the Eastern time zone. Weekend Nielsen ratings for nonmajors that Woods played in 2007, and missed this year due to injury, have dropped about 33 percent.

So instead of tuning in to the BMW Championship and Tour Championship at 3 p.m. on Saturday, viewers will have to deal with an extra early start at 12:30.
